Thursday just wasn't the day for Liberty's offense. They fell 3-0 to the Freeman Scotties on Thursday. Having soared to a lofty 13 runs in the game before, the Lancers' shutout was a dramatic turnaround.
Liberty saw three different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Aubrey Hofmann, who went 1-for-3 with one stolen base.
Liberty's defeat was their first in the district, dropping their district record down to 6-1 and their overall record down to 8-2. As for Freeman, the victory keeps they at an undefeated 12-0.
The teams didn't have to wait long for a rematch: the Scotties beat Liberty by a score of 3-1 later that day.
